Developing an Eye for Observing Bees

The speaker has trained their eye to observe bees in videos by labeling numerous frames, allowing them to quickly identify and understand the behavior of individual bees even when others find it chaotic. Slowing down footage helps in identifying bees' positions and behaviors, such as their distinctive antennae positions. The argument that bees' behaviors are purely mechanical, like a wind-up toy, is challenged by the speaker, who believes that even with computation involved, there is no clear dividing line between mechanical and sentient behavior, drawing an analogy to the skeletal or muscle systems.
